A Darker Dive into Panem's History

Collins sets the stage with the 50th Hunger Games, also referred to as the Second Quarter Quell, a substantial event that initially appeared briefly in Catching Fire. For this particular Quell, the Capitol imposed a terrible twist by doubling the number of tributes, forcing two boys and two ladies from each district to get involved. The Capitol's manipulation of the Games as a type of control is pressed to new extremes, emphasizing the dehumanizing phenomenon of violence that dominates Panem's society.

Sunrise on the Reaping provides readers a deeper understanding of how the Capitol asserts its supremacy over the districts. By increasing the number of tributes, the stakes in the arena are not just greater, however the mental weight of the Games magnifies for both the homages and their households. The Capitol's insistence on these escalating scaries acts as a reminder of its stranglehold on Panem and its capability to press the limits of cruelty, justifying it as penalty for past rebellions.

Collins utilizes this setting to clarify Panem's much deeper history and offers insights into how the political environment of the Capitol progressed during this duration. Readers will likely see how the early days of the Hunger Games shaped Panem's approval of this twisted yearly ritual and how the districts started to respond to the overwhelming cruelty troubled them.

The Complex Character of Haymitch Abernathy

A fan-favorite character from the original series, Haymitch Abernathy lastly takes center stage in Sunrise on the Reaping. Through this unique, readers will get to experience Haymitch's painful journey through the Games, showing not simply how he won but the psychological and physical toll that his victory handled him. Haymitch was constantly provided as a deeply problematic character-- an alcoholic and a cynic-- however Sunrise on the Reaping promises to offer a richer understanding of his transformation from a clever, resourceful victor to the seasoned man who coaches Katniss and Peeta years later.

Collins has actually already meant the turning point when Haymitch's tactical genius enabled him to endure. Throughout the 50th Hunger Games, he famously utilized the arena's forcefield to turn his challenger's weapon against her. However, what was as soon as a quick stating will now be expanded upon in visceral detail. The novel is anticipated to show the personal expense of this victory-- how outsmarting the Capitol not only won Haymitch the Games however also resulted in the deaths of his liked ones, bought by President Snow as penalty.

Through this story, Collins checks out the emotional scars left by the Games, painting Haymitch not just as a victor, but as a victim of the Capitol's callous ruthlessness. His fluctuate show the deeply destructive effects of survival in the arena, where winning does not imply flexibility however continued subjugation to the Capitol's whims.
